Abstract: | Dynamic crack propagation speeds along the weakly jointed interfaces of PMMA and Homalite-100 were determined experimentally.
These speeds were found to be highly dependent on the bonding strength and on the magnitude of the applied impulsive loads.
As applied loads increase, the maximal speed was found to approach asymptotically the Rayleigh wave velocity of the material.
Paper was presented at the 1985 SEM Spring Conference on Experimental Mechanics held in Las Vegas, NV on June 9–14. |
